New England Writers' Centre Fellowship


The Varuna-New England Writers’ Centre Fellowship offers:

One week of full board and accommodation at Varuna including:

  • a prepared evening meal,

  • uninterrupted time to write in your own private studio, 

  • the companionship of your fellow writers 

  • and a one-hour Varuna conversation with a Varuna consultant.

This fellowship also includes $350 towards travel and payment of the Varuna alumni fee of $99.

What New England Writers’ Centre are looking for: 

New England Writers’ Centre welcome manuscripts at any stage of development from writers who are currently living in the federal electorate of New England or have lived in this electorate in the past for a period of five years or more (see https://www.aec.gov.au/profiles/nsw/new-england.htm). Writers can be at any point in their career, and working in any form of literary creation. 

This includes fiction, drama, poetry, children’s books, and narrative non-fiction.

WHAT NEW ENGLAND WRITERS’ CENTRE IS LOOKING FOR

A panel of New England Writers’ Centre assessors will establish a shortlist, and Varuna will make the final choice between the shortlisted entries.

Artistic merit is the most important criterion for our assessors, who are looking for strongly written characters, sound structure, compelling themes and a distinctive and engaging voice.

Assessors also consider the potential of the manuscript, based on the experience of the writer and their work plan.
